Real Madrid consider comeback for Lyon striker Mariano Diaz

Real Madrid are reportedly considering whether to rehire Lyon striker Mariano Diaz.

Diaz, 25, spent five years at Santiago Bernabeu before he was sold to the Ligue 1 outfit in 2017. A flurry of 21 goals in 45 appearances have followed.

Marca have reported that such form has piqued the interest of the Spain-born, Dominican Republic international’s former employers.

Los Blancos view him as an alternative target to Bayern Munich’s Robert Lewandowski, Internazionale’s Mauro Icardi and RB Leipzig’s Timo Werner.
